Transaction e34be030c5147411317b5c86ed4420cdb7a6907436e36197af6fbf032a5f7bb9

1 Input
2 Outputs
  • e34be030c5147411317b5c86ed4420cdb7a6907436e36197af6fbf032a5f7bb9:0
  • value  1840910
    address  35CCG4d2a9tEBMEqwUgpDo7CvcYWgqQoCa
  • e34be030c5147411317b5c86ed4420cdb7a6907436e36197af6fbf032a5f7bb9:1
  • value  25174998
    address  3CfaH9Y3o5vdwqEagkcMLey5ca61cfpJ4a